Brief summary

Many people who have kidney failure require hemodialysis treatments to stay alive. Hemodialysis is a procedure that cleans the blood of the toxins and fluids that build up when kidneys don't work. Most patients receive hemodialysis treatment three times every week and each treatment lasts 4 hours. These patients spend 156 days per year receiving hemodialysis treatments. This is a very large time burden which has a tremendous impact on well-being and life satisfaction. Current usual approach of prescribing three hemodialysis treatments per week is not based on good studies and assumes that all people need the same number of hemodialysis treatments per week regardless of their age, values, life expectancy or other health conditions. Over time, increasingly more elderly people are needing to start hemodialysis treatments. The investigators have conducted a preliminary study that shows that patients who are 70 years of age or older can do well when only receiving only two hemodialysis treatments per week. In this preliminary study, receiving two hemodialysis treatments per week was no different than three hemodialysis treatments per week with regards to important safety measures including blood values and management of body fluid levels. The investigators now propose to carry out a much larger study in many centers across Canada that will compare two times per week hemodialysis treatments to three times per week hemodialysis treatments in elderly patients who have reached kidney failure and are beginning their hemodialysis journey. The investigators want to know if receiving hemodialysis treatments twice per week increases the number of days that a patient is able to spend at home without increasing rates of hospitalization or death compared to receiving hemodialysis treatments three times per week. The investigators also want to know if this is better for people's quality of life, safe, less expensive for the health care system and friendlier to the environment. The results of this study will help elderly patients needing to start hemodialysis treatments, medical care teams who help make decisions about how many hemodialysis treatments per week are necessary as well as kidney organizations that oversee kidney care for patients in Canada and around the world.

Inclusion criteria

1. patients aged 70 or above 2. have developed end stage kidney disease and require hemodialysis treatment

Exclusion criteria

1. Hospitalized patients without an alternate level of care designation 2. Those with missed hemodialysis sessions due to non-adherence during the first 7 weeks of hemodialysis treatment 3. Patients already prescribed twice weekly hemodialysis 4. Patients who are medically unsuitable as per primary care team and site investigator 5. anticipated significant barriers to ascertainment of patient-reported experience measures

Design outcomes

Primary

MeasureTime frameDescription
Days Alive and Out of Hospital365 daysDays Alive and Out of Hospital is an important patient-centered goal and outcome that approximates time spent at home.

Secondary

MeasureTime frameDescription
Days Alive and Out of Hospital2 yearsDays Alive and Out of Hospital is an important patient-centered goal and outcome that approximates time spent at home
Quality-adjusted life years2 yearsImpact of treatment frequency on Quality-adjusted life years
Change in Edmonton Symptom Assessment Scale-revised Renal score from baseline to average of all follow-up assessments2 yearsImpact of treatment frequency on Quality of Life measures as assessed by the Edmonton Symptom Assessment Scale-revised Renal instrument (range 0-120 with higher scores mean a worse quality of life)
Change in Kidney Dialysis and Quality of Life-36 scores from baseline to average of all follow-up assessments2 yearsImpact of treatment frequency on quality of life as assessed by the Kidney Dialysis and Quality of Life-36 instrument (Each subscale score ranges from 0-100 where higher scores mean a better quality of life)
Clinical Frailty Scale score2 yearsAverage of all follow-up Clinical Frailty Scale score assessments controlling for baseline (range 1-9 with higher scores meaning higher frailty)
Number of urgent unscheduled hemodialysis treatment for hyperkalemia2 yearsImpact of intervention on potassium control
Number of urgent unscheduled hemodialysis treatment for volume overload2 yearsImpact of treatment frequency on volume overload
Weekly pre-hemodialysis potassium levels > 5.9 mmol/L2 yearsImpact of treatment frequency on potassium control
Change in urine volume2 yearsImpact of treatment frequency on volume of urine output
Hospitalization2 yearsImpact of treatment frequency on the number and days of hospitalization
Kidney function recovery2 yearsImpact of treatment frequency on the number of participants recovering kidney function
Elective withdrawal from hemodialysis treatment2 yearsImpact of treatment frequency on the number of participants who choose to withdraw electively from hemodialysis treatment
Cost2 yearsImpact of treatment frequency on health care cost attributed to hemodialysis treatment
Environmental costs attributed to hemodialysis treatment2 yearsImpact of treatment frequency on the environmental cost attributed to hemodialysis treatment
mortality2 yearsimpact of treatment frequency on mortality
